An alternative admin panel for Lektor.
Project description
lektor-tekir is an alternative admin panel for Lektor.
What works:
Navigating content.
Adding, editing and deleting content items.
Adding, deleting and replacing attachments.
Publishing (deploying) the site.
Multiple language support in the UI (English and Turkish at the moment).
Support for light/dark mode preference.
A widget for navigating content elements in the site.
What’s planned in the short term:
Editing attachments.
Editing system fields.
Dividing edit form fields into tabs.
Supporting Git.
Managing content translations.
TinyMCE, Quill or some other editor integration.
What’s planned in the longer term:
Managing databags.
Markdown editor integration.
Managing everything (templates, static assets, models, flow blocks, etc).
It can be installed using pip:
pip install lektor-tekir
To use it, run:
lektor-tekir serve
And use the edit buttons on pages.
The lektor-tekir CLI is identical to the Lektor CLI except that it patches the serve command to enable its own panel.
All icons are from the Breeze project.
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Hashes for lektor_tekir-0.5-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| bba306016ba0483988091eec2b11d1bc61748dbcf562833ac7b75db8c9afe6ca |
|
MD5 | 090dd1f2250520aa1e212ee3e2a276bd |
|
BLAKE2b-256 | 7617c3fb1e2e682645608cb43531ec29332fb92e356f788f03de1f0e17dae394 |